dotnet vstest

6       This article applies to: ✔️ .NET Core 2.1 SDK and later versions
7
8              [!IMPORTANT]  The  dotnet vstest command is superseded by dotnet
9              test, which can now be used to run assemblies.  See dotnet test.
10

NAME

12       dotnet-vstest - Runs tests from the specified assemblies.
13

SYNOPSIS

15              dotnet vstest [<TEST_FILE_NAMES>] [--Blame] [--Diag <PATH_TO_LOG_FILE>]
16                  [--Framework <FRAMEWORK>] [--InIsolation] [-lt|--ListTests <FILE_NAME>]
17                  [--logger <LOGGER_URI/FRIENDLY_NAME>] [--Parallel]
18                  [--ParentProcessId <PROCESS_ID>] [--Platform] <PLATFORM_TYPE>
19                  [--Port <PORT>] [--ResultsDirectory<PATH>] [--Settings <SETTINGS_FILE>]
20                  [--TestAdapterPath <PATH>] [--TestCaseFilter <EXPRESSION>]
21                  [--Tests <TEST_NAMES>] [[--] <args>...]]
22
23              dotnet vstest -?|--Help
24

DESCRIPTION

26       The dotnet-vstest command runs the VSTest.Console command-line applica‐
27       tion to run automated unit tests.
28
29   Arguments
30TEST_FILE_NAMES
31
32         Run  tests from the specified assemblies.  Separate multiple test as‐
33         sembly names with spaces.  Wildcards are supported.
34

OPTIONS

36--Blame
37
38         Runs the tests in blame mode.  This option is  helpful  in  isolating
39         the problematic tests causing test host to crash.  It creates an out‐
40         put file in the current directory as Sequence.xml that  captures  the
41         order of tests execution before the crash.
42
43--Diag <PATH_TO_LOG_FILE>
44
45         Enables  verbose logs for the test platform.  Logs are written to the
46         provided file.
47
48--Framework <FRAMEWORK>
49
50         Target .NET Framework version used for test execution.   Examples  of
51         valid   values  are  .NETFramework,Version=v4.6  or  .NETCoreApp,Ver‐
52         sion=v1.0.  Other  supported  values  are  Framework40,  Framework45,
53         FrameworkCore10, and FrameworkUap10.
54
55--InIsolation
56
57         Runs the tests in an isolated process.  This makes vstest.console.exe
58         process less likely to be stopped on an error in the tests, but tests
59         may run slower.
60
61-lt|--ListTests <FILE_NAME>
62
63         Lists all discovered tests from the given test container.
64
65--logger <LOGGER_URI/FRIENDLY_NAME>
66
67         Specify a logger for test results.
68
69         • To  publish test results to Team Foundation Server, use the TfsPub‐
70           lisher logger provider:
71
72                  /logger:TfsPublisher;
73                      Collection=<team project collection url>;
74                      BuildName=<build name>;
75                      TeamProject=<team project name>
76                      [;Platform=<Defaults to "Any CPU">]
77                      [;Flavor=<Defaults to "Debug">]
78                      [;RunTitle=<title>]
79
80         • To log results to a Visual Studio Test Results File (TRX), use  the
81           trx  logger  provider.   This switch creates a file in the test re‐
82           sults directory with given log file  name.   If  LogFileName  isn’t
83           provided, a unique file name is created to hold the test results.
84
85                  /logger:trx [;LogFileName=<Defaults to unique file name>]
86
87--Parallel
88
89         Run  tests  in  parallel.  By default, all available cores on the ma‐
90         chine are available for use.  Specify an explicit number of cores  by
91         setting  the  MaxCpuCount property under the RunConfiguration node in
92         the runsettings file.
93
94--ParentProcessId <PROCESS_ID>
95
96         Process ID of the parent process responsible for launching  the  cur‐
97         rent process.
98
99--Platform <PLATFORM_TYPE>
100
101         Target  platform  architecture used for test execution.  Valid values
102         are x86, x64, and ARM.
103
104--Port <PORT>
105
106         Specifies the port for the socket connection and receiving the  event
107         messages.
108
109--ResultsDirectory:<PATH>
110
111         Test  results  directory will be created in specified path if not ex‐
112         ists.
113
114--Settings <SETTINGS_FILE>
115
116         Settings to use when running tests.
117
118--TestAdapterPath <PATH>
119
120         Use custom test adapters from a given path (if any) in the test run.
121
122--TestCaseFilter <EXPRESSION>
123
124         Run tests that match the given expression.  <EXPRESSION>  is  of  the
125         format  <property>Operator<value>[|&<EXPRESSION>],  where Operator is
126         one of =, !=, or ~.  Operator ~ has `contains' semantics and  is  ap‐
127         plicable  for string properties like DisplayName.  Parentheses () are
128         used to group subexpressions.  For  more  information,  see  TestCase
129         filter            (https://github.com/Microsoft/vstest-docs/blob/mas
130         ter/docs/filter.md).
131
132--Tests <TEST_NAMES>
133
134         Run tests with names that match the provided values.  Separate multi‐
135         ple values with commas.
136
137-?|--Help
138
139         Prints out a short help for the command.
140
141@<file>
142
143         Reads response file for more options.
144
145args
146
147         Specifies  extra  arguments  to  pass  to the adapter.  Arguments are
148         specified as name-value pairs of the form <n>=<v>, where <n>  is  the
149         argument name and <v> is the argument value.  Use a space to separate
150         multiple arguments.
151

EXAMPLES

153       Run tests in mytestproject.dll:
154
155              dotnet vstest mytestproject.dll
156
157       Run tests in mytestproject.dll, exporting to custom folder with  custom
158       name:
159
160              dotnet vstest mytestproject.dll --logger:"trx;LogFileName=custom_file_name.trx" --ResultsDirectory:custom/file/path
161
162       Run tests in mytestproject.dll and myothertestproject.exe:
163
164              dotnet vstest mytestproject.dll myothertestproject.exe
165
166       Run TestMethod1 tests:
167
168              dotnet vstest /Tests:TestMethod1
169
170       Run TestMethod1 and TestMethod2 tests:
171
172              dotnet vstest /Tests:TestMethod1,TestMethod2
